The 25th Annual Putnam County Spelling Bee

This musical is the delightful story of six fidgety adolescents attempting to correctly spell "pyrrhonism" while vying for the spelling championship of a lifetime.  Along the way the students learn that winning isn't everything and that losing doesn't necessarily make you a "loser".  This Tony Award-winning hit musical features infectious music and a charming cast of quirky characters sure to tickle your funny-bone.  Plus, you may even get a chance to join the cast on stage and spell some words yourself!
